PC Friars Men’s Soccer Ranked #12 in US Coaches Preseason Poll

The United Soccer Coaches NCAA Men's Soccer preseason rankings for the upcoming season were just released and the Providence Friars are checking in at the number 12 spot.  The #12 ranking is the highest of any team in the Big East, with Creighton following at #14 and Butler rounding out the rankings at #25.
